To import data from a text file into Microsoft Excel, follow this step-by-step guide: First, create a blank spreadsheet in Microsoft Excel and ensure you have the .txt file on your PC.

Click on the Data button and then select the From Text option in the area of the ribbon labeled Get External Data. Open Text Import Wizard Locate your saved text file and double click it.
